From her early days in New Hampshire to the global spotlight of 1600 Pennsylvania Avenue, her journey is a story of ambition, faith, and determination\u2014and one that few could have predicted.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Early Life and Ambition<\/h4>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Born on August 24, 1997, in Atkinson, New Hampshire, Karoline grew up understanding the value of hard work. Her parents owned an ice cream stand, where she spent countless summers helping out, learning responsibility and perseverance. She attended Central Catholic High School in Lawrence, Massachusetts, where her Catholic education instilled discipline, a sense of public service, and a strong connection to faith\u2014values she still credits for shaping her character today.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Leavitt earned a softball scholarship to Saint Anselm College in Manchester, New Hampshire, playing outfield for the Hawks. She credits athletics with teaching her teamwork, determination, and focus\u2014skills that seamlessly translated to her political career. While in college, she founded the Saint Anselm Broadcasting Club, volunteered at the New Hampshire Institute of Politics, and wrote opinion pieces for the student newspaper, demonstrating her early political engagement. Her dedication was evident\u2014she skipped football games and social events to focus on writing a standout application. After a semester studying abroad in Rome at John Cabot University, she returned to the U.S. and became the first in her family to earn an undergraduate degree.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Between 2019 and 2021, Leavitt worked as assistant press secretary under Kayleigh McEnany, preparing briefings and gaining firsthand experience in the high-pressure world of White House communications. After the 2020 election, she became Director of Communications for Republican Rep. Elise Stefanik and even ran for Congress in New Hampshire\u2019s 1st District, winning the Republican primary before narrowly losing the general election.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\">A Historic Appointment<\/h4>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">In 2024, after working as press secretary for Donald Trump\u2019s campaign, Karoline Leavitt achieved an unprecedented milestone: she was named White House Press Secretary at just 27 years old, surpassing Ronald Ziegler\u2019s record from the Nixon administration. In 2022, she met her husband, Nicholas Riccio, who is 32 years her senior. The couple announced their engagement in December 2023 and welcomed their first son, Niko, in July 2024. They married on January 4, 2025, just days before Trump\u2019s inauguration. Leavitt often describes their relationship as \u201ca very atypical love story,\u201d praising Riccio\u2019s support, especially as she navigates a demanding career while embracing motherhood.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Even amid the chaos of the White House, Leavitt prioritizes family time. \u201cI spend every second I can with my son when I\u2019m home,\u201d she shared, acknowledging the challenges working mothers face and the guilt that often comes with balancing career and family.
